Microsoft and NetApp have promoted the Azure NetApp Files (ANF) application volume group feature to general availability, and NetApp has documented it as the standard provisioning method for SAP HANA volumes on ANF. The feature replaces per-volume manual placement that used to require Azure-team intervention for HANA-sized workloads, and bundles data, log, and shared volumes into a single SAP HANA–aware group with deterministic placement on the underlying ANF capacity pool.
Why it matters: it is the canonical ANF workflow for HANA going forward (manual volume-by-volume provisioning will be deprecated), it removes the manual Azure escalation step, and it gives architects a stable IaC target — every HANA system on Azure ends up with the same volume layout. The NetApp video series covers single-host, scale-up, HSR, MCOS, MDC and standby HANA topologies and their required volume maps.
